BIG RAILWAY VIADUCT.
BRIDGE OVER THE MOHAKA. GISBORNE, April 2. It is reported at Wairoa that VickersLtd., whoso representative was through the district some time back, have obtained a contract for an extensive viaduct over the Mohata River, on the route of the East Coast Railway. When erected it will the highest in the Southern Hemisphere, being 373 ft. above the water.
